OK this thread has been derailed and hijacked by a couple most wanted terrorist on FRF. lol
Getting back on track, GEN1 or GEN2 if you are planning to keep the truck beyond the factory warranty just buy an extended warranty. There is no nickel and dime stuff here. They are expensive trucks and like any machines they do break down. One claim can cover the cost of the warranty.... If you like playing Russian roulette don't get it, just simple.
My truck is covered BTB up to 102k miles, $100 deductible. Already used it once for telescopic steering motor. Under $800 claim...my in house cost on the 4/48k mile warranty was $1600, i am a dealer. You do the math....
